Footage released from Morgan Wallen's 2024 arrest for throwing a chair off of Eric Church's Chief's bar and restaurant in Nashville shows the country music superstar asking officers if he will be allowed to fix his hair before taking his mug shot.

Following several minutes of investigation, an officer told Wallen he was video recorded throwing a chair into lane two of traffic next to an MNPD patrol car, body camera footage said. The officer took Wallen's wrist and placed the country singer under arrest.
